## 3.2.0 — Changed defaults

Squatwatch now treats edit-distance-1 package names as high severity by default, up from medium. The nightly registry sweep also shifted from weekly to daily, so support should expect more alert volume from customers on default settings. Customers who tuned thresholds manually are unaffected. Homoglyph detection remains opt-in. If a customer asks why alerts increased after upgrading, point them at this release. The new default values are as follows.

deployment values, kajep-kageg:
[praix]
host = praix.paliqcorp.corp
user = praix_svc
database = praix_prod

Handover: docs-lint duty for Quillmark

The linter runs on every merge to the docs branch and flags broken anchors, stale version strings, and missing frontmatter. Config lives in the lint-rules folder; Farrow owns the style rules. If the lint cache gets corrupted, wipe it and re-seed using the passphrase that follows.

strongbox words: prawyn-fenmir

# LiftSim Environments

LiftSim (elevator-dispatch simulator) has two environments: dev and bench. Dev runs a single simulated bank with deterministic passenger arrivals. Bench runs the full Marlow Tower scenario with stochastic load for performance comparisons. Reviewers: dispatch-algorithm changes must pass bench regression before merge; dev-only runs don't count. All scenario knobs live in config, never in code. Bench currently uses the following configuration values.

settings of fafog-haduf:
ZORIX_PIN=4648
ZORIX_METRICS_HOST=metrics.zorix.paliqsys.corp
ZORIX_LOG_LEVEL=info
ZORIX_TENANT=druix

The Harbexa partner SFTP drop receives nightly settlement files from our clearing partners. Under normal operation, transfers run through the Quillgate automation account and no human ever touches credentials. If Quillgate is down and a partner file must be pulled manually before the 06:00 cutoff, declare a break-glass event in the ops channel, page the duty lead, and log your reason in the access register. Once the event is acknowledged, unlock the drop's emergency credential bundle with the recovery passphrase shown directly below.

unlock words, kagef-taduf: fenir-quenix-norwyn-sorvan-gormir-gorir-fraok